49:48Now PlayingKouri Richins is back in court as the judge addresses several issues like a defense request to dismiss all charges. Richins is accused of killing her husband, Eric Richins, with a lethal dose of fentanyl, and then writing a children's book on grief. Her attorney said the state had unfairly accused Richins of witness tampering after her "Walk The Dog" letter was found in her cell. Prosecutors claim the letter contains instructions for her brother to lie in court.
The judge ultimately denied the motion to dismiss. Richins' trial moves forward.
